Technical Problem

Traditional multi-layer laminating machines cannot calculate the length of the material strip in real time, which makes it impossible to achieve digital control of the winding and unwinding devices, and impossible to automatically remove waste and optimize the control of the material roll.

Method used

By detecting the rotary encoder signals of the winding and unwinding drive motor shafts, combined with the angular displacement sensor of the tension floating roller shaft, the roll diameter and strip length are calculated, enabling online detection and data accumulation to obtain strip length data of the laminating machine at any time.

Benefits of technology

Digital control of the multi-layer composite machine has been achieved, which can automatically remove waste materials, optimize the control of residual material in the roll, and improve production efficiency and accuracy.

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to solvent-free laminating machines, and more particularly to an online detection and calculation method for the length of the material strip in a multilayer laminating machine. Background Technology

[0002] Multilayer laminating machines are widely used in the food and other packaging industries. Traditional laminating machines cannot calculate the roll diameter and material length, as well as the length of the material strip in the path, in real time. Therefore, they cannot perform various digital controls on the unwinding and winding devices, such as automatic and accurate removal of waste film and estimation of reasonable winding diameter. They also cannot optimize the minimum remaining material length for valuable strips or digitally record the joints in the winding roll. The root cause of this problem is the inability to calculate the material strip length online in real time. Summary of the Invention

[0032] As an improvement, the specific steps of step (S2) are as follows:

[0033] (S21) Install a floating roller swing arm and an angular displacement sensor to detect the rotation angle of the floating roller shaft on the tension floating roller shaft. The swing roller is installed on the floating roller swing arm. When the floating roller swing arm rotates, the output value of the angular displacement sensor changes linearly. During machine debugging, the range of the measured output value is set to correspond to the left and right extreme swing positions of the swing arm, and the midpoint of the output value is in the middle position of the swing arm.

[0034] (S22) Based on the reading range of the angular displacement sensor and the actual swing range of the swing arm, set several corresponding relationship groups consisting of two sets of values: angular displacement reading and swing arm rotation angle;

[0035] (S23) Calculate or use a mapping method to obtain the length L of the material strip along the path of the two fixed guide rollers before and after the floating roller at each set angle. TNX ;

[0036] The length of the material path when the floating roller is in the middle position of the swing is L, which is the length of the material path when the tension floating roller section is in the middle position of the swing arm. TN0 ;

[0037] The path length L of the floating roller segment at each of the remaining swing angles TNX With L TN0 The difference (L) TNX -L TN0 ) represents the path strip length sway deviation value Δ of the tension floating roller segment corresponding to the angular displacement reading data. LTN The corresponding relationship is listed in the path strip length deviation table of the tension floating roller section;

[0038] (S24) During detection, read the output value on the angular displacement sensor and look up the corresponding deviation value Δ of the path length of the tension floating roller section in the path length deviation table. LTN And the length L of the path strip of the tension floating roller section when it is in the middle position of the swing arm. TN0 The sum of the two values ​​is the length L of the path material of the tension floating roller section at the moment of detection. TN ;

[0039] L TN =L TN0 +△ LTN0 (9)

[0040] (S25) When the angular displacement sensor reading cannot be found in the table, it is calculated using linear interpolation.

[0100] A method for online detection and calculation of strip length in a multi-layer laminating machine is illustrated in this embodiment, using a three-layer laminating machine as an example. Figure 1 As shown, the laminating machine includes a first unwinding device, a second unwinding device, a third unwinding device, a winding device, a coating device, and a laminating device. The first unwinding device corresponds to unwinding a first base material roll 1, and includes a first unwinding shaft, a first unwinding drive motor, and a first rotary encoder disposed at the end of the first unwinding drive motor shaft. The second unwinding device corresponds to unwinding a second base material roll 2, and includes a second unwinding shaft, a second unwinding drive motor, and a second rotary encoder disposed at the end of the second unwinding drive motor shaft. The third unwinding device corresponds to unwinding a third base material roll 3, and includes a third unwinding shaft, a third unwinding drive motor, and a third rotary encoder disposed at the end of the third unwinding drive motor shaft. The winding device corresponds to the composite film roll 4 of the composite film, and includes a winding shaft, a winding drive motor, and a winding rotary encoder disposed at the end of the winding drive motor shaft. The coating device includes a first coating unit 9 for coating the first base material strip and a second coating unit 10 for coating the second base material strip. The composite device includes a composite unit 11 for composite of a first base material strip, a second base material strip, and a third base material strip. The composite unit 11 includes a composite steel roller and a composite rubber roller.

[0101] The first unwinding path, from front to back, includes a first base material roll 1, a first unwinding fixed roller 5, a first unwinding path first floating roller device 12, a first coating unit 9, a first unwinding path second floating roller device 13, and a composite unit 11. The first unwinding path also includes a front guide roller 20 and a rear guide roller 21 of the first unwinding path first floating roller device 12, and a rear guide roller 22 of the first unwinding path second floating roller device 13. The second unwinding path, from front to back, includes a second base material roll 2, a second unwinding fixed roller 6, a second unwinding path first floating roller device 14, a second coating unit 10, and a second unwinding path. The second unwinding path includes a second floating roller device 15 and a composite unit 11. The second unwinding path also includes a front guide roller 24 and a rear guide roller 23 of the first floating roller device 14, and a rear guide roller 25 of the second floating roller device 15. The third unwinding path, from front to back, includes a third base material roll 3, a third unwinding fixed roller 7, a first floating roller device 16, and a composite unit 11. The third unwinding path also includes a front guide roller 26 and a rear guide roller 27 of the first floating roller device 16. The winding path, from front to back, includes a composite unit 11, a winding fixed roller 8, and a composite film roll 4. For example... Figure 2 As shown, each floating roller device has the same structure, including a floating roller swing arm 29, a swing roller 28 installed at the lower end of the floating roller swing arm 29, a tension floating roller shaft 30 installed at the upper end of the floating roller swing arm 29, and a digital angular displacement sensor 31 for detecting the rotational position of the floating roller shaft.

[0187] The second method for calculating the roll diameter at the time of detection using the winding and unwinding device is suitable for situations where the machine operates smoothly or where the requirements for the calculation results are not strict.

[0188] Based on the path and material strip length obtained by automatic detection and calculation, this invention further calculates various length values ​​for automatic and accurate shutdown and rejection of waste material during film cutting, automatic determination of the shortest waste material cutting position during material roll replacement, and the winding diameter when the unwinding of the material roll is completed during startup, providing a foundation for the automatic control of the above functions.
